believe not only to me but to others as well. This ten year old girl, Chihiro,
is all alone in some odd and mystical world while her parents, because of
greed, were turned into pigs as she is under a life contract by some witch lady
with an oversized baby. This girl not only develops bravery but
she shows the characteristic to be grateful for where she is and what
she has. She shows us that you have to fight for what's right and face your fears
when times get dark. And I give her props because spirits and ghosts are
not my thing.
